Indonesia’s Gresik ready to take stake in Baturaja
06 May 2010


President-director of Indonesian cement maker PT Semen Gresik, Dwi Sutjipto, said the company is ready to take over the shares of PT Semen Baturaja.
 
"The acquisition would build a synergy in the Semen Gresik group," Dwi Sutjipto said after a hearing with Commission VI of the House of Representatives in Jakarta Wednesday.
Sutjipto said taking over the cement plant is a strategy taken by the company to boost its production capacity.
 
"We have been making the necessary preparations for taking over the cement company," Sutjipto said.
But he did not reveal what it cost to take over the company, and said the corporate action also depends on the wishes of the shareholders.
 
Sutjipto also said that Semen Baturaja could always be developed separately.
In the meantime, president director of Semen Baturaja, Pamudji Rahardjo, said the acquisition of Semen Baturaja is still awaiting a direction from the State Enterprises Minister as a majority shareholder.
